The performance of several column packings has been assessed and it has been stressed that low eluent flow rates are necessary for high performance separation. The effects of water contamination in eluents has been studied by Berek et a/. " highlighting the need for rigorou dried systems. Phase equilibria studies in polymer-polymer-solvent systems have proved feasible using a dual detection system and could be extended in the future. Other applications are concerned with copolymer analysis, polydispersity, oligomers, and melamine-formaldehyde and urea— and phenol-formaldehyde resins. New techniques, recycle liquid SEC, phase-distribution chromatography, and the measurement of diffusion coefficients from GPC have been described. [Pg.249]
